Discover LudwigThe phrase "a sentencing recommendation"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used in legal contexts when discussing suggestions made by a judge or legal authority regarding the appropriate punishment for a convicted individual.
Example: "The judge considered the prosecutor's a sentencing recommendation before making a final decision on the case."
Alternatives: "a sentencing suggestion" or "a penalty recommendation."
